If you refer to driver in [1] I have some concerns: i.MX27 VPU should
be implemented as a V4L2 mem2mem device since it gets raw pictures
from memory and outputs encoded frames to memory (some discussion
about the subject can be fond here [2]), as Exynos driver from Samsung
does. However, this driver you've mentioned doesn't do that: it just
creates several mapping regions so that the actual functionality is
implemented in user space by a library provided by Freescale, which
regarding i.MX27 it is also GPL.

What we are trying to do is implementing all the functionality in
kernel space using mem2mem V4L2 framework so that it can be accepted
in mainline.
